Taxonomic Classification

Rank Brush Rabbit Red River hog
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class same Mammalia (Mammals)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Lagomorpha (Rabbits & Hares) Artiodactyla (Even-toed Ungulates)
Family Leporidae (Rabbits & Hares) Suidae (Pigs)
Genus Sylvilagus Potamochoerus
Species Sylvilagus bachmani Potamochoerus porcus

Evolutionary Relationship

Brush Rabbit and Red River hog share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Mammals)
